The book explores the emergence of capitalist consumerism in nineteenth-century England, highlighting the rise of department stores and shopping arcades during the Victorian era. It contrasts the material abundance enjoyed by the affluent with the struggles of the lower classes, particularly during the 'Hungry Forties,' when many faced dire shortages of basic necessities. This examination reveals the complexities of economic progress and social disparity during a transformative period in British history.
